The traditional approach to per diem staffing is built around urgency but not efficiency. It relies heavily on manual processes that slow everything down just when speed is most important. Recruiters are often stuck in a loop of phone calls, voicemails, texts, and emails—trying to match open shifts with available talent, usually without real-time data.
Compliance adds another layer of friction.
Making sure credentials are up to date and onboarding is complete often requires someone to dig through documents or double-check expiration dates. That kind of delay isn’t just frustrating—it can cost you the shift entirely.
Today’s most effective staffing firms are ditching the spreadsheets and switching to platforms designed for speed.
Automation enables instant communication with clinicians through mobile apps. A shift becomes available, and the system automatically alerts clinicians who meet the qualifications. They can accept the job with a tap—no phone tag required.
This doesn’t just reduce time-to-fill; it creates a more seamless experience for everyone involved. Schedulers aren’t stuck making cold calls. Clinicians don’t have to wait for a text. And facilities don’t have to worry about whether a shift will go unfilled.
Artificial intelligence takes all of this a step further. Instead of simply looking at who’s available, AI-driven scheduling tools can make smarter, faster decisions by analyzing a range of data points: a clinician’s past shift history, credentials, performance ratings, preferred locations, and even average commute times.
The result is better matches and fewer cancellations.
Clinicians are more likely to accept a shift that fits their schedule and preferences. Facilities get someone who’s not just available, but the right fit for the job.
